The four games

  • Excuse Plot: It just wouldn't be Mario if it didn't have it.
  • It's the Same, Now It Sucks: Every game in the series invoked this reaction from people due to it being a 2D platformer, and it gets worse with every new installment.
  • Most Annoying Sound: The "PAH!" sound that permeates most of the music in the series.

The DS game

  • And the Fandom Rejoiced: it was the first 2D Mario platformer in 14 years. It was kind of a given that people were gonna be excited about it.
    • The sequel brings back the Racoon Suit, and you can actually fly again!
  • Angst? What Angst?: Mario (or Luigi) certainly doesn't have any qualms seeing Bowser get Stripped to the Bone after the first boss battle; they just say their end-of-boss phrase cheerfully and move on.
  • Crowning Music of Awesome: The Castle theme.
    • The overworld theme is pretty catchy, too.
    • The Platforms-a-Plenty theme from Super Mario Sunshine returns slightly arranged as the music for the Trampoline Time minigame.
  • Fridge Logic: Why does Bowser Jr keep screwing time waiting for Mario to beat each world boss to drag Peach to the next world when he could just run all the way to the last castle without wasting time?
  • It's Easy, So It Sucks: A lot of people feel this way. Even Miyamoto has stated that he regrets making it too easy. [dead link]
  • Power-Up Letdown: The Mega Mushroom looks awesome, but if you break a pipe, you can't go down it, ruining your chances of potentially finding a Star Coin. Also, the Blue Shell handles awkwardly with its sliding mechanic, though it does improve your swimming. The Mini Mushroom, meanwhile, lets you jump higher and with (much) floatier physics, as well as access certain areas otherwise inaccessible, with the drawback that it has zero hit points; one hit from anything will kill you. When you're going for all the Star Coins and have to use it in the later levels where things get hectic...all those lives you accumulated in the early levels are going to come in handy.
